概括
这项研究引入了两种深度学习模型,用于使用心脏声音快速,经济高效地诊断心脏病. 长期短期记忆 - 卷积神经 (LSCN) 模型实现了高精度,优于早期心血管疾病检测的现有方法.

主要方法:
- 提出了两个深度学习模型:一个多分支深度卷积神经网络 (MBDCN) 和一个长期短期记忆卷积神经网络 (LSCN).
- MBDCN利用多种不同的过器尺寸和功率频谱输入来增强功能提取,模仿听觉处理.
- LSCN将LSTM块与MBDCN集成,以改善时间域特征提取,增强心脏声音分析.
主要成果:
- 该LSCN模型实现了89.65%的多类分类精度和93.93%的二进制分类精度.
- 两种拟议的模型都显著优于传统方法,如Mel频率曲系数 (MFCC) 和波形变换.
- 五次交叉验证证实了所提出的深度学习方法的稳定性和可靠性.
